Webb20 maj 2015 · Philosophers Path is the best walk in Kyoto. It's a 2 kilometer stone path (30 minute walk) that winds past charming shops, cafes and traditional houses.The path follows a stone canal (Lake Biwa Canal) that's lined with hundreds of cherry trees. It's one of the best hanami spots in Kyoto.It's also popular in the autumn for its fall foliage. WebbPhilosopher’s Path. The Philosopher’s Path (Tetsugaku no michi, 哲学の道) is a stoned paved walking trail and a popular touristic sight in Kyoto. The Philosopher’s Path is located near Ginkakuji Temple, towards Nanzenji Temple and it takes approx 30 mins to complete.
